The P.C.U.P.S. program, which is now called the P.C.U.P.S. Foundation started in March 2012. P.C.U.P.S. stands for Prostate Cancer Understanding Prevention Screenings. The intent of this program was designed to help increase the awareness to men’s health and wellness by providing Prostate Specific Antigen blood screenings (PSA). In October 2011, Tom Albrecht approached Marlette Regional Hospital about combining efforts to raise funds and create a higher awareness in the fight against cancer. From this meeting, the P.C.U.P.S. Program was created. The first ever fundraising event for P.C.U.P.S. came from a promotional event called Hunting for Health. Since March 2012, the P.C.U.P.S. program has raised over $80,000 and has paid for over 1,000 PSA screenings. Currently, P.C.U.P.S. Foundation has awarded grants to six hospitals throughout the thumb region and works with the University of Michigan Comprehensive Cancer Center - Urology Department. The P.C.U.P.S. Foundation is savings lives!
